Gallstones can sometimes cause more serious problems such as pancreatitis or infections in the gallbladder or bile ducts. These can cause fever, more severe abdominal pain, or jaundice (a yellow color of the skin or whites of the eyes).
WebKey Points. Most ( ≥ 95%) patients with acute cholecystitis have cholelithiasis. In older patients, symptoms of cholecystitis may be nonspecific (eg, anorexia, vomiting, malaise, weakness), and fever may be absent. miniature fruits and vegetablesWebCholedocholithiasis is the most common cause of cholangitis, inflammation and infection of your common bile duct. Backed-up bile causes your bile duct to swell, which further slows the flow of bile.
